Output df4debe63d439f68ba0862a7ca906cf504a99c9dc7674281602c6ab51b0016ca:2

value
50515156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e72942a8ac74b5104a4c81a1b963e84a87c7753 OP_EQUALVERIFY OP_CHECKSIG
address
1DzCDK8yERxQPhypUiKqFhiF6ZiFjyQTLL
transaction
df4debe63d439f68ba0862a7ca906cf504a99c9dc7674281602c6ab51b0016ca
confirmations
444070
spent
true